Going to disagree. Lv36 queen. Fairly low war hero of 365, but they've all been on big th10s.
She is far harder to control, but more rewarding.
It is also very rare that she plain ignores jump spells. The most common are that there are buildings to the side of her that delays her jumping far longer than you'd like.
That's a regular prelude to the one proper jump AI fail of where your ground troops then destroy all the buildings in the target jump box. She doesn't then jump even though it would still provide plenty of targets in range.
On compartmented war bases she can be far more efficient when you keep her on track. People seem to forget how much time queen would waste bashing walls around the core under previous AI, when there were loads in reach with just a step.
This can then be a great advantage against th9 farm bases, where she can move through the core taking the middle ringed storages. This would rarely happen to full effect before, she would want to bash into an empty box on a regular basis.
Its the secondary funnel that is the make or break. The flanks must continue pushing through at a similar rate to the middle main force, otherwise there's dumb stuff left off to the sides to chase.
Obviously only my personal preference I can speak for, but I say the building hp buff proves to an extent she is better now.
I see an awful lot of well directed attacks getting at least as many of not more % than before, which requires a lot more damage done across the base.
I do also see a lot of poorly constructed, or average standard attacks mixed with a touch of bad luck that do very badly. (I've done all 3, but more of the former after first couple days).
I'm for extra effort/accuracy bringing better reward.
